Overview

Barrington Park Playground South is a free outdoor playground in Christchurch with a strong focus on young children's play. The equipment includes a sandpit with interactive contraptions, a rock climbing cave, multiple spinning toys, a wind-up piano, a walkable seesaw, swings, slides, and a distinctive upside-down tree structure built for hide and seek. The layout is wide and spacious with pram-accessible paths.
